Alert: LoadRamp checkout soak test tripped the latency guard. The synthetic checkout flow on Vexbury staging is seeing p95 above 2.5s during the 500-VU ramp, and payment-stub timeouts are climbing. Probably the cart service again, but check the connection pool first before restarting anything. If it's still red after 15 minutes, page the Tidepool squad. Triage steps and dashboards are linked on this page.

wiki page, tahaf-tajog: https://jira.ordindyn.corp/pipeline

## Break-Glass Access: Fleet Fuel-Usage Report (Torvane Logistics)

If the nightly fleet fuel-usage report fails and the owning team at the Dunmore depot is unreachable, break-glass access lets you regenerate it manually. Use this only when the report is more than six hours late, and record your action in the access log afterward. Open the Torvane reporting console, select the emergency profile, and authenticate. When prompted, enter the break-glass recovery passphrase, which follows below.

recovery phrase for fawif-tajeg: norael-aldmir-casir-brivan-ulaion

# Break-Glass: Ledgersight Audit-Log Viewer

Use only if normal SSO is down and an incident requires log access. Page the secondary on-call first. Break-glass grants read-only admin for 4 hours; all actions are recorded. Open the sealed escrow record in the Coldharrow safe app, confirm the checksum, then unlock. File an incident note afterward. The recovery passphrase is on the next line.

unlock words, hahip-yagef: zorok-novmir-zorix-silax

It handles zoom-level eviction, sharded warm-up on deploy, and the overlay invalidation hooks used by the Marrowdale basemap team. Changes here require benchmark runs against the standard coastline fixture set, and any eviction-policy modification needs explicit approval. Review questions about cache keys, shard topology, or the warm-up scheduler should go directly to the maintainer. The current owner of this component is named below.

approver of yahig-hahof = Oliath Praix